Cross system installation of web applications
    1.
    发明授权
    Cross system installation of web applications 有权
    跨系统安装Web应用程序

    公开(公告)号:US09465596B2

    公开(公告)日:2016-10-11

    申请号:US13648473

    申请日:2012-10-10

    Applicant: Google Inc.

    CPC classification number: G06F8/61 G06F9/45504

    Abstract: A method and system for providing cross system installation of applications, include providing for installation, via a server, a natively operating application coded only with web technologies, and providing for installation a single runtime environment that provides the natively operating application access to computer system-level services that are not available to web applications. The single runtime environment controls the installation and uninstallation of the natively operating application, and the natively operating application is configured to execute independent of a web browser.

    Abstract translation: 一种用于提供跨系统安装应用程序的方法和系统,包括通过服务器提供仅使用Web技术编码的本地操作应用程序的安装,以及为安装提供本机操作的应用程序访问计算机系统的单个运行时环境, Web应用程序不可用的高级服务。 单个运行时环境控制本地操作应用程序的安装和卸载,并将本机操作的应用程序配置为独立于Web浏览器执行。

    Push notifications for web applications and browser extensions
    2.
    发明授权
    Push notifications for web applications and browser extensions 有权
    推送网路应用程式和浏览器扩充功能的通知

    公开(公告)号:US09451039B1

    公开(公告)日:2016-09-20

    申请号:US14250877

    申请日:2014-04-11

    Applicant: GOOGLE INC.

    CPC classification number: H04L67/26 G06F21/00 G06F21/44 H04L29/06 H04L63/08

    Abstract: A system includes a memory configured to store executable code and a processor operably coupled to the memory. The processor is configured to execute the code to receive a request from a developer of a first web application to provide a notification corresponding to the first web application, authenticate the developer using a client identifier, after authenticating the developer, receive a content of the notification and a first user identifier, and provide the content of the notification to at least one of a plurality of computing devices associated with the first user identifier, based on an account associated with the first user identifier. The system syncs the notification and a plurality of computing devices associated with the first user identifier, based on the account.

    Abstract translation: 系统包括被配置为存储可执行代码的存储器和可操作地耦合到存储器的处理器。 处理器被配置为执行代码以接收来自第一web应用的开发者的请求,以提供对应于第一web应用的通知,在认证开发者之后,使用客户识别符对开发者进行认证,接收通知的内容 和第一用户标识符,并且基于与第一用户标识符相关联的帐户,向与第一用户标识符相关联的多个计算设备中的至少一个提供通知的内容。 该系统基于该帐户来同步通知和与第一用户标识符相关联的多个计算设备。

    SYSTEM FOR DISTRIBUTING COMPONENTS
    3.
    发明申请

    公开(公告)号:US20180314510A1

    公开(公告)日:2018-11-01

    申请号:US14273137

    申请日:2014-05-08

    Applicant: GOOGLE INC.

    Abstract: A method and system include providing a staged release of multiple components of a native application, updating at least one of the multiple components. The updating may occur over multiple channels for each updated component. The multiple channels correspond to different builds of the native application.

    CROSS SYSTEM INSTALLATION OF WEB APPLICATIONS
    4.
    发明申请
    CROSS SYSTEM INSTALLATION OF WEB APPLICATIONS 有权
    WEB应用程序的跨系统安装

    公开(公告)号:US20140089914A1

    公开(公告)日:2014-03-27

    申请号:US13648473

    申请日:2012-10-10

    Applicant: Google Inc.

    CPC classification number: G06F8/61 G06F9/45504

    Abstract: A method and system for providing cross system installation of applications, include providing for installation, via a server, a natively operating application coded only with web technologies, and providing for installation a single runtime environment that provides the natively operating application access to computer system-level services that are not available to web applications. The single runtime environment controls the installation and uninstallation of the natively operating application, and the natively operating application is configured to execute independent of a web browser.

    Abstract translation: 一种用于提供跨系统安装应用程序的方法和系统,包括通过服务器提供仅使用Web技术编码的本地操作应用程序的安装,以及为安装提供本机操作的应用程序访问计算机系统的单个运行时环境, Web应用程序不可用的高级服务。 单个运行时环境控制本地操作应用程序的安装和卸载,并将本机操作的应用程序配置为独立于Web浏览器执行。

Patent Agency Ranking